Ingredients
For the Salad:
- 2 large cucumbers, sliced
- 2 large tomatoes, chopped
- 1 medium red onion, thinly sliced
For the Dressing:
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
Optional Add-Ins:
- ¼ cup feta cheese, crumbled
- ¼ cup black olives, sliced
- 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
Instructions
Step 1: Prepare the Vegetables
- In a large bowl, combine the sliced cucumbers, chopped tomatoes, and thinly sliced red onion.
Step 2: Make the Dressing
- In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, red wine vinegar, oregano, salt, and black pepper.
Step 3: Combine and Serve
- Pour the dressing over the vegetables and toss to coat evenly.
- If using, add the feta cheese, black olives, and fresh parsley.
-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 1 hour to let the flavors meld.
Tips for Success
- Use fresh, ripe vegetables for the best flavor.
- For a creamier dressing, add a tablespoon of Greek yogurt or mayonnaise.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 2 days.

Health Benefits of Key Ingredients:
- Cucumbers: High in water content and low in calories, great for hydration.
- Tomatoes: Packed with vitamins A and C, as well as antioxidants like lycopene.
- Red Onions: Rich in antioxidants and add a tangy flavor.
- Olive Oil: Provides healthy fats and antioxidants.
